Timebomb Duels Mobile Controls

Mobile Touch Layout

Mobile Timebomb Duels uses Roblox default dynamic thumbstick on the left side of the screen. Jump button appears on the right. Camera control uses touch drag on the right side of the screen when not using fixed camera modes.

Tagging works the same — run into players with the bomb. Touch input can feel less precise for rapid ankle breaking and 360 spins compared to mouse flicks.

Shift Lock on Mobile

Native Roblox shift lock is not available on mobile unless the game developer scripts a custom shift lock button. Timebomb Duels Alpha does not provide a custom shift lock UI for mobile players. This is a significant competitive disadvantage.

Some mobile players use external controllers or cloud gaming with keyboard/mouse for better results. Casual mobile play in Free-for-All remains accessible and fun.

Mobile Performance

Lower device heat and close other apps to reduce touch latency. Mobile ping varies more on cellular networks — prefer Wi-Fi for competitive sessions. Enable performance stats if available to monitor network ping.

Tips for Mobile Players

Focus on map knowledge and positioning over advanced tech. Use larger circular movement in 1v1 rather than complex jukes. Practice in Free-for-All. Consider PC for tournament-level play where shift lock is mandatory.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can mobile players compete?
Casually yes, but PC with shift lock dominates high-level play due to strafing limitations.
Shift lock on iPhone/Android?
Not natively supported in Roblox mobile without game-specific scripts.
Best mobile control mode?
Default dynamic thumbstick with follow camera. Classic mode may help some players.
